James Cameron May Not Direct the Final ‘Avatar’ Films

Avatar movie director James Cameron has no plans on directing the Final Avatar movies. Currently, he is busy with the production of Avatar: The Way of Water, which is scheduled to release this year on December 16. Let’s find out more about what is cooking in James Cameron’s mind and his plans.

James Cameron may or may not be directing the future films of Avatar

Some sources reveal that Canadian filmmaker James Cameron may not be there to direct the forthcoming movies of the Avatar franchise. In an interview with Empire, the director shared that the films are all-consuming. He also said that he has other movie projects in his mind. And those projects are still in the works which he is excited to share with the world.

Some sources reveal there will be fourth and fifth installments of this popular sci-fi franchise. However, the most celebrated filmmaker James Cameron is not going to be a part of both of these films. He also revealed that he wants to pass the baton to someone else.

The Canadian director further added that he is currently focusing on his future films and won’t be a part of the next installments of the Avatar franchise. As of now, Cameron is waiting for the second installment of Avatar: The Way and Water.

Here is what he has to say to the Avatar fans: “I think eventually over time — I don’t know if that’s after three or after four — I’ll want to pass the baton to a director that I trust to take over, so I can go do some other stuff that I’m also interested in. Or maybe not. I don’t know.”

The Canadian director went on to say that the movie franchise gave him the canvas to talk about subjects that are important in real life, which include climate, sustainability, as well as family. “Everything I need to say about family, about sustainability, about climate, about the natural world, the themes that are important to me in real life and my cinematic life, I can say on this canvas,” he added.

More Details About Avatar: The Way Of Water

“Avatar: The Way Of Water” is an upcoming science-fiction film, which is set after the events of the first 2009 Avatar movie. The movie centers around the Sully family (Jake, Neytiri, and their kids), the problems that follow them, the tragedies they face, and to what extent they can go to keep each other safe. The movie comes from 20th Century Studio that stars Sam Worthington, Zoe Saldana, Kate Winslet, Sigourney Weaver, Edie Falco, Michelle Yeoh, Giovanni Ribisi, Stephen Lang, Oona Chaplin, and Jermaine Clement.
